I wanted to see what you all thought of this.

I know the minimum amount of posts here is 50 posts in order to gain access to private messaging. However, this causes a lot of people to post things such as:

"thanks for this"
"this is good information"
"I agree with you"
"this is correct"
so on and so on.

Do you think users should have to have their first 50 posts manually reviewed to look for any spam considered messages?

Or do you think that the word limit to make a post should be increased?

    Originally Posted by GhostWriting View Post

    Do you think users should have to have their first 50 posts manually reviewed to look for any spam considered messages?
    I think they more or less are, effectively. By members. In the sense that if someone's made 50 one-line posts, they're going to get one or two of them reported with a "many one-line posts" comment, and suddenly the next time you look their post-count will be 15, or something.

    Originally Posted by GhostWriting View Post

    Or do you think that the word limit to make a post should be increased?
    As someone who does post some facetious one-liners, I suppose I have to say "no" to that ... I do see where you're coming from, of course.

    I think the current system, including member-moderation-by-reporting, works pretty well, most of the time. Admittedly there are always a few "Saturday spammers and anonymous trolls", but they do get removed. (Especially anyone promoting knock-off Louboutin shoes at stupid prices, because I'm on a mission to watch out for those.)

    The moderators do a tremendous job.
